ZIP 76033 and ZIP 76035 are ZIP Code areas in Texas.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 76033 has the higher population (28,246 vs 3,247 in ZIP 76035). ZIP 76035 has the higher median household income ($99,355 vs $69,870 in ZIP 76033). ZIP 76035 has the higher median home value ($387,400 vs $230,600 in ZIP 76033).
